    Desktop problem


    Hi all
    I've been trying for the last 2 hours to get to my desktop after waking it from sleep - when I did, the appearance was really weird with the start menu over-laid onto the desktop, with no desktop or taskbar icons showing. I managed to get the taskbar icons back by right-clicking the taskbar - but there's only 3 options available (see screenshot attached)

    I've logged off, restarted, cold-restarted but it's always as in the s/shot - can't right-click for Task Manager or anything other than the 3 options shown. I've logged into my wife's account and her's is fine/normal - it's just mine!

    Anyone have any suggestions please?

    I believe you get yourself into Tablet Mode.
    At far right of your taskbar, next to Time, there is a Notification icon > click it > click Tablet Mode.
    Does that bring back your desktop ?

    Thanks for taking the time to reply. That's all it was!! ....dunno how that's happened, must've been a system glitch on wake-up because I certainly never enabled it. Thank you very much indeed David.
